Addressing EV Charging Challenges: Effective Solutions for a Sustainable Future
As electric vehicles (EVs) become increasingly popular, understanding the specific challenges associated with EV charging is crucial. This article delves into the most pressing issues faced by EV owners and businesses alike, highlighting innovative solutions designed to overcome these barriers and foster the growth of EV adoption.

Understanding EV Charging Challenges
The transition to electric vehicles is critical for achieving a sustainable future, yet various challenges impede the smooth integration of EV charging infrastructure. Below are some notable EV charging challenges:
1. Insufficient Charging Infrastructure
One of the primary challenges is the inadequacy of charging stations. Many urban areas lack sufficient charging points, leading to range anxiety among potential EV users.
**Solutions:**
- Government Initiatives: Incentivizing installations in public areas through grants and subsidies.
- Private Investments: Encouraging businesses to install charging stations at workplaces and retail locations.
2. Charging Speed and Accessibility
Not all chargers are created equal; slow charging can hinder EV usage. Furthermore, accessibility for individuals with disabilities is often overlooked.
**Solutions:**
- Fast Chargers: Expanding the use of Level 3 fast chargers that significantly reduce charging time.
- Universal Design: Ensuring that charging stations adhere to accessibility standards.
3. Energy Demand and Grid Capacity
The increased adoption of EVs can lead to considerable pressure on the energy grid, especially during peak hours.
**Solutions:**
- Diverse Energy Sources: Investing in renewable energy sources such as solar and wind to meet demand.
- Smart Grids: Implementing smart grid technology that optimizes energy distribution and usage.
4. High Installation Costs
The cost of installing home charging stations can be prohibitive, limiting EV uptake.
**Solutions:**
- Incentives and Rebates: Governments can offer incentives to reduce overall costs.
- Standardization: Advocating for standardized equipment to lower installation costs.
5. Payment and Compatibility Issues
The absence of a universal payment system and charger compatibility can leave users frustrated.
**Solutions:**
- Unified Payment Systems: Promoting the development of apps that allow payment across multiple charging networks.
- Standardized Connectors: Advocating for a common charging standard that all vehicles can utilize.
6. User Education and Awareness
Many potential EV owners lack understanding about charging logistics, leading to misconceptions and hesitancy.
**Solutions:**
- Public Awareness Campaigns: Launching educational initiatives to inform consumers about the benefits of EVs and how to use charging networks effectively.
- Manufacturer Guidance: Providing detailed guidance on charging through user manuals and apps.
7. Environmental Concerns Related to Battery Production
The production of EV batteries raises environmental concerns due to resource-intensive processes.
**Solutions:**
- Sustainable Mining Practices: Encouraging manufacturers to utilize eco-friendly methods for extracting battery materials.
- Recycling Programs: Promoting battery recycling initiatives to reduce environmental impacts when EVs reach the end of their lifecycle.
